Output e88d581b0f5b9e4760eb821387ce14c6b769e4551cf4b90367a2badd5d0cf618:34

value
13592439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03900aeeef7bac1036e360f3b7289a20ca956ac5 OP_EQUAL
address
M8DzpGXXoSmu4pUPiaGpAAhe9oogm4pT8R
transaction
e88d581b0f5b9e4760eb821387ce14c6b769e4551cf4b90367a2badd5d0cf618
spent
true